Natalie Harp’s Resurfaced Jan 6 Tweets Reveal 150 Pro-Trump Posts

August 23, 2026 Emma Walker – News Editor News

Natalie Harp, a special assistant to the president, posted over 150 pro-Trump messages on X, formerly known as Twitter, on January 6, 2021. According to reporting by CNN, the now-deactivated account featured repeated endorsements of claims that the 2020 presidential election was stolen, alongside expressions of support for demonstrators gathered at the U.S. Capitol.

## Social Media Activity on January 6
The posts authored by Harp, who was 29 at the time, frequently echoed talking points regarding the election outcome. In one instance, she typed “FIGHT FOR TRUMP!” 12 times in a single post. Throughout the day, she described the crowd assembled for the president’s speech as “patriots” and issued a call to action, stating, “today we STOP THE STEAL!”

As the events of the day unfolded, Harp continued to post, writing during the president’s speech, “We will never give up. We will never concede!” Other posts from that day included the declaration, “Today, DC is TRUMP COUNTRY!”

## Broader Support for Election Fraud Narratives
The social media activity reported by CNN indicates that Harp’s public alignment with the president’s election-fraud narrative predated the Capitol riot. In the weeks leading up to January 6, she told her followers, “We will never give up – for TRUTH is on our side. January 6th is coming!!”

Records of the account also show Harp’s reaction to the November 2020 election results, where she posted, “WE LOVE YOU! WE LOVE YOU! WE LOVE YOU! x 71 million.” On December 14, 2020, she characterized the certification of the results as “THIS IS A COUP.” In a separate 2021 interview with then-congressional candidate Karoline Leavitt, which was unearthed recently, Harp claimed that Donald Trump had won the state of New Hampshire, despite official results showing he trailed Joe Biden by 7.4 percent.

## Current Role and Institutional Scrutiny
Harp, now 35, serves as a special assistant to the president and executive assistant, with an annual salary of $150,000. Within the Trump administration, she has become known for her near-constant presence alongside the president and her role in providing him with printed materials, earning her the unofficial title of “human printer.”

Recent scrutiny of Harp has extended beyond her social media history to include her personal correspondence with the president. The Daily Beast reported on letters written by Harp in 2023 in which she referred to Trump as her “Guardian and Protector in this Life” and wrote, “You are all that matters to me.”

The X account referenced in these reports was opened in 2016 and appears to be suspended. It remains unconfirmed whether the account was deactivated by Harp or the platform.
